Examine Sprinkler Heads for Damage and Clogs



Before you activate your sprinkler system for the season, it's important to examine the sprinkler heads for any damage or obstructions. Beginning by examining each head visually. Search for fractures, breaks, or any signs of wear that might influence their efficiency. Next, remove any debris, such as dust or lawn, that could be blocking the nozzles. When the system turns on., you'll want to guarantee that water can move easily.


If you observe any stopped up heads, remove them and soak them in a remedy of vinegar and water to dissolve mineral down payments. Taking these actions will assist ensure your sprinkler system operates successfully throughout the season.


Examine and Adjust Lawn sprinkler Insurance coverage



Stroll around your backyard while the system is running and observe the spray patterns. Change the angle of the sprinkler heads if needed; you can normally twist them to redirect the water flow.


If you observe any kind of completely dry places, take into consideration raising the heads or installing additional ones to complete gaps. For areas that receive too much water, lower the heads or adjust the radius settings if your sprinklers have that feature. Irrigation repair and service near me. Pay attention to any overlapping coverage, as this can cause waste. Putting in the time to make improvements these modifications will guarantee your yard and garden receive the best amount of water, advertising healthy and balanced growth throughout the period.

Check the Controller and Timers



Testing the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ler system is essential for keeping a reliable watering schedule. Make sure the day and time are right; this assurances your system runs as intended.


Run a hand-operated examination cycle for every zone to validate it triggers properly. Look for any type of malfunctions or hold-ups, as these might indicate concerns needing focus. Change the run times and regularity if you observe any type of areas are over- or under-watered.


Additionally, familiarize Get More Info on your own with the rain hold-up function if your controller has one; it helps save water during damp periods. Regularly checking your controller and timers not only conserves water but additionally promotes much healthier plants and a dynamic landscape.


Tidy Filters and Screens



Consistently cleaning filters and screens is essential for maintaining your lawn sprinkler functioning successfully. With time, dust, mineral, and debris accumulation can obstruct these components, causing unequal water circulation and decreased performance. Begin by situating the filters and displays in your system, which are frequently discovered at the major line and specific sprinkler heads.


Once you've recognized them, transform off the water system and meticulously remove each filter or screen. Rinse them under running water to remove any type of accumulation. For persistent down payments, make use of a soft brush and light cleaning agent, but avoid severe chemicals that might damage the parts.


After cleansing, reassemble every little thing and double-check for any kind of noticeable wear or damages. If you notice anything unusual, consider replacing the screens or filters to guarantee peak performance - Sprinkler installation. By keeping clean filters and screens, you'll help your automatic sprinkler run efficiently and properly

Inspect Pressure Scale



One essential facet of preserving your automatic sprinkler is examining the pressure scale to confirm perfect water stress. You must on a regular basis monitor this scale, as proper stress guarantees your system runs efficiently. Initially, look for the advised pressure variety, usually in between 30 to 50 PSI, depending on your system's requirements. If the analysis's also low, your lawn sprinklers will not disperse water properly, resulting in completely dry spots. On the other hand, high pressure can trigger damages to your system and unequal watering. Take note of them if you observe any kind of discrepancies. Doing this easy check can conserve you time and cash, and maintain your yard healthy and eco-friendly. Make it a habit to check the gauge at the beginning of each season for optimum efficiency.

Inspect Lawn Sprinkler Heads



Evaluating your sprinkler heads is important for evaluating water stress and making certain also circulation throughout your lawn. Beginning by checking each head for blockages or damage. Clear any kind of debris or dust that could be blocking the flow. Next off, observe the spray pattern; it ought to be regular and reach the desired areas without merging. If you observe uneven insurance coverage, change the heads as necessary or read this article replace any kind of that are broken. Furthermore, analyze the water pressure at each head; also high can cause misting, while as well reduced may lead to not enough watering. If you find disparities, you might need to change your stress regulator or consult an expert. Regular evaluation assists keep a healthy, lively landscape and protects against drainage.
